Hi Paul,Not really worth the bother ... once you have all that stuff discon=
nected.removed it really is little more work to lift the gearbox out entire=
ly.=20
A word of caution.=20
After encountering clutch shudder more than once after installing a new clu=
tch I would strongly recommend getting the flywheel resurfaced. It is an in=
expensive job to have done at a competent auto machine shop and is a lot le=
ss work than pulling everything out again.
